引言

Bootstrap 是一个流行的前端框架,它可以帮助开发者快速搭建响应式网页。妙味课堂作为国内知名的IT教育机构,提供了丰富的Bootstrap视频教程,帮助学员轻松掌握这一技能。本文将为您揭秘妙味课堂的Bootstrap视频教程,让您快速成为响应式网页设计的行家。

一、妙味课堂Bootstrap教程概述

1. 教程内容

妙味课堂的Bootstrap教程涵盖了从基础到进阶的各个方面,包括:

  • Bootstrap 简介
  • 基本布局和样式
  • 响应式设计
  • 组件使用
  • 插件应用
  • 案例解析

2. 教学特点

  • 系统化教学:教程按照从基础到进阶的顺序进行讲解,帮助学员逐步掌握Bootstrap。
  • 实战性强:教程中包含大量实战案例,帮助学员将理论知识应用于实际项目中。
  • 通俗易懂:讲师语言幽默风趣,讲解清晰,让学员轻松理解复杂概念。
  • 更新及时:教程内容紧跟Bootstrap版本更新,确保学员学习到最新的知识。

二、Bootstrap教程核心内容详解

1. Bootstrap 简介

Bootstrap 是一个基于HTML、CSS和JavaScript的前端框架,它提供了一套响应式、移动设备优先的样式库。通过使用Bootstrap,开发者可以快速搭建美观、响应式的网页。

2. 基本布局和样式

Bootstrap 提供了一套基本的布局和样式,包括栅格系统、容器、行、列等。通过合理使用这些布局和样式,可以快速搭建出符合设计要求的网页结构。

<!DOCTYPE html>
<html lang="zh-CN">
<head>
  <meta charset="UTF-8">
  <meta name="viewport" content="width=device-width, initial-scale=1.0">
  <link rel="stylesheet" href="https://cdn.staticfile.org/twitter-bootstrap/4.3.1/css/bootstrap.min.css">
  <title>Bootstrap 基本布局</title>
</head>
<body>

  <div class="container">
    <div class="row">
      <div class="col-md-8">左侧内容</div>
      <div class="col-md-4">右侧内容</div>
    </div>
  </div>

</body>
</html>

3. 响应式设计

Bootstrap 的栅格系统可以实现响应式设计,通过不同屏幕尺寸下的列数调整,实现网页在不同设备上的适配。

<div class="container">
  <div class="row">
    <div class="col-xs-12 col-md-8">响应式布局</div>
    <div class="col-xs-12 col-md-4">响应式布局</div>
  </div>
</div>

4. 组件使用

Bootstrap 提供了丰富的组件,如按钮、表单、导航栏等。通过使用这些组件,可以快速搭建出美观、实用的网页界面。

<button type="button" class="btn btn-primary">按钮</button>
<form>
  <div class="form-group">
    <label for="inputEmail">邮箱地址</label>
    <input type="email" class="form-control" id="inputEmail" placeholder="请输入邮箱地址">
  </div>
</form>

5. 插件应用

Bootstrap 提供了丰富的插件,如模态框、下拉菜单、滚动条等。通过使用这些插件,可以增强网页的交互性和用户体验。

<!-- 模态框 -->
<div class="modal fade" id="myMod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
  <div class="modal-dialog" role="document">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="myModalLabel">模态框标题</h5>
        <button type="button" class="close" data-dismiss="modal" aria-label="Close">
          <span aria-hidden="true">&times;</span>
        </button>
      </div>
      <div class="modal-body">
        模态框内容...
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-secondary" data-dismiss="modal">关闭</button>
        <button type="button" class="btn btn-primary">确定</button>
      </div>
    </div>
  </div>
</div>

6. 案例解析

妙味课堂的Bootstrap教程中包含大量实战案例,帮助学员将所学知识应用于实际项目中。例如,制作一个响应式博客网站、企业官网等。

三、总结

掌握Bootstrap,可以帮助开发者快速搭建响应式网页。妙味课堂的Bootstrap视频教程内容丰富、实战性强,是学习Bootstrap的绝佳选择。通过学习这些教程,您将能够轻松应对各种网页设计需求。